Major Birmingham Route Blocked After Morning Collision

A significant crash caused the closure of a key Birmingham commuter route during the busy morning rush hour on Tuesday, November 18. The A4540 Lawley Middleway, a vital ring road connecting Digbeth and Bordesley Green, was shut in both directions following the incident.

Police Response and Road Closure Details

West Midlands Police were called to the scene and confirmed they were dealing with a collision. A force spokesperson stated, "We're currently at the scene of a collision in Lawley Middleway. Officers are at the scene carrying out enquiries and drivers are advised to find alternate routes."

The road was completely closed between Garrison Circus and Curzon Circus, causing a major disruption for thousands of morning commuters. Police indicated they could not provide further updates at that initial stage.

Widespread Travel Disruption and Official Warnings

The closure led to long delays and heavy congestion in the surrounding area. Official traffic monitoring service Inrix reported the road was blocked in both directions due to the police incident, with traffic building from Great Barr Street to Vauxhall Road.

West Midlands Roads issued a stark warning to drivers on social media platform X, advising of the northbound closure on the anti-clockwise ring road. Their post urged motorists to "allow extra time for your journey and consider alternative routes where possible."

Authorities repeatedly emphasised the need for drivers to find other paths for their travel while emergency services and investigators worked at the scene.
